Punctuated equilibrium proposes that rather than evolution occurring as a steady state of gradual change, real natural change comes about through long periods of stasis, interrupted by some cataclysmic event that propels upward, evolutionary adjustment. Gersick's work indicates that teams develop operating norms rather quickly and will operate under these norms until a trigger event, occurring halfway between the initial meeting and the project's due date, causes a change in norms and better task performance.
